Heavy rainfall is not the only cause of flooding. Interior problems like ruptured pipelines and also overflows can result in emergency flooding. This will certainly additionally create damages to your building. Failing to attend to the issue will escalate the damages and also boost the possibilities of mold and mildew growth. Keep on reading to figure out what you can when taking care of emergency flooding.
1. Switch Off Key Water Valve
Pipelines can burst because of freezing temps, high pressure, clog, hot water heater problems, and other elements. Regardless of the cause, you have to act swiftly to make certain permeable home products, devices, as well as furnishings do not soak up the water, leading to damages. Shut off the primary shutoff before you do any type of cleansing to make certain water quits pouring in. Eliminating the water resource is simple, and also it is something you can do on your own. As for the burst pipeline, ask for emergency plumbing services to fix it immediately.
2. Shut Off the Breaker
With a large flooding, you need to make sure the power is out.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electric outlets, it can trigger injuries or fatalities. Switch off the circuit breaker to stop electrocution. If you can refrain from doing it, make a fast contact us to the power company to close the primary line. Maintain the power off until excess water is gone.
3. Relocate Important Damp Times
When it comes to saving your home furnishings and home appliances, time is important. You must relocate whatever sharpen valuables you can from the affected location to a dry area. This prevents further damages because the longer they soak in water, the a lot more comprehensive the issue.
4. File the Extent of Damages
Keep in mind of all the damages brought upon by the ruptured pipe. You can make a note of notes, take photos, and accumulate video clips. This is a terrific way to offer proof to gather claims on your residence insurance coverage. With documents, you can also obtain a clear picture of the level of the damage.
5. Remove Water ASAP
You must obtain rid of excess water as quickly as possible. Ought to there be a large amount of standing water, you might require a water pump for extraction. When minimal water is left, you can saturate up the remainder with old t-shirts or towels.
6. Dry the Area
You can additionally set up electrical followers as well as placed them in the strongest setting. A dehumidifier additionally functions in taking out dampness to protect against mildew and mold and mildews.
7. Work with Professionals
When you experience comprehensive water damage due to emergency flooding from a burst pipeline, you can deal with a repair professional to rebuild and refurbish your house. Most importantly, do not neglect to call a reliable plumbing technician to take care of the burst pipe and check the remainder of your piping system. Surviving the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ations
If you reside in a storm-prone area, you ought to be used now on what to do, where to go and also what to need to be prepared for negative weather. Nonetheless, if you're not used to getting pummeled by high winds and also tough rain, you possibly do not have an suggestion how best to deal with a tornado situation.
For beginners, tornados do not just come without a warning. Weather stations keep an eye on the ambience all the time. If a storm is possible, they will issue 2 sorts of cautions:
Storm watch-- is provided when there is a possible storm in your area. You probably will be experiencing a dark, cloudy sky, an unusually windy day as well as some rain. The tornado may or might not come, but this is the moment to keep tuned to your regional radio for news and updates.
Tornado caution-- is issued when a tornado is headed toward your location. By that time, the roads could be swamped as well as traffic is poor. You don't desire to be caught in your auto in poor climate.
Blizzard-- generally happens in winter as well as suggests heavy snow, solid winds and wind chill. When a caution is issued, prevent taking a trip as high as feasible and stay inside. There is no use exposing on your own outdoors where you can obtain trapped in web traffic or in places where you will certainly be hard to reach or worse, find.
Things don't constantly go bad throughout tornados, however weather is unpredictable and also anything can occur. To help you prepare for a tornado emergency situation, here are a couple of ideas:
Dress up.
Put on enough clothes to maintain yourself cozy. Heat might not be available in your house so obtain additional layers as well as coverings to preserve your body temperature completely.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and boots prepared also.
Have food prepared.
Emergency provisions are a should during tornado emergency situations. If the storm obtains also bad as well as the streets are swamped, you will certainly have a difficulty going out to the grocery store stores.
Maintain containers of water handy. Clean water may be difficult ahead by throughout really negative conditions and the worst thing you can do is experience dehydration since you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at least one gallon for every person each day that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.
Fill the tub.
You'll require a lot more water for cleaning as well as flushing the commodes. When the power is out, your water pump won't operate, so best load your tub, water containers and also containers with water. If you have children in your house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ers and maintaining youngsters away from the shower room unless needed.
Emergency situation kit
Have a medical or very first package ready and make certain it's freshly-stocked. It ought to include disinfectants,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as necessary medicines. It's likewise a great concept to have another package in your cars and truck.
If anybody in your household is under unique medication, make sure you have adequate materials to last until after the tornado mores than as well as medicine shops are open.
Lights off
Anticipate power outages throughout tornado emergencies. You won't have any kind of power, so stock on candle lights, flashlights and also emergency situation lights. Have additional fresh batteries and suits in case you run out.
If you can not turn on the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your area. Media will certainly check the tornado and will certainly keep you updated.
You could need hot water throughout the duration when power is not yet offered, so keep a little container of gas around just in case. Your outside barbecue grill will certainly do perfectly.
Get an alternate shelter.
Make sure you have adequate gas in your tank in situation you need to obtain out of the house and also relocation someplace. Maintain to a higher ground where you have far better chances of being secure and dry.
